Young people may feel they are carrying the weight of the world on their shoulders when in reality they are too often carrying an excessively heavy backpack. The article “Effectiveness of a School-Based Backpack Health Promotion Program” (Work, 2003: 113–123) reported the following data for a sample of 131 sixth graders: for backpack weight (lbs),
= 13.83, s = 5.05; for backpack weight as a percentage of body weight, a 95% CI for the population mean was (13.62; 15.89). a. Calculate and interpret a 99% CI for population mean backpack weight. b. Obtain a 99% CI for population mean weight as a percentage of body weight. c. The American Academy of Orthopedic Surgeons recommends that backpack weight be at most 10% of body weight. What does your calculation of part (b) suggest and why?
